Output 26ecda4e037ecf46d9ca55631db70627b8a764f67a0bb3fee5fea15e93b82d0a:0

value
9369761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2557b5ef5b3f8c883c62b8d9ae9e58730127cb68 OP_EQUAL
address
356TztNp6LWtMPJ6DyEqtm31NGNYtEeXZs
transaction
26ecda4e037ecf46d9ca55631db70627b8a764f67a0bb3fee5fea15e93b82d0a
spent
true